Executive Summary:
Monetary conditions, which includes Fed policy, remain exceptionally/historically favorable. Both economic data and corporate earnings have been coming in better than expected. Inflation, while showing some signs of life recently, isn't likely to be a problem for stocks in the foreseeable future. And while valuations are clearly high, this is a fairly common occurrence in post-recession market cycles (see explanation below). Thus, my take is the fundamentals continue to support the bull case.
